*Right alongside the extensive Duracrete contract mines, Corellian Engineering Corporation mines continued to spew forth their own low but sustained level of ore, to be sorted and processed carefully, then sent to the Selonian Shipyards for use in the limited local commercial production taking place there. These mines did not amount to a significant percentage of the total volume taken from the planet, however, as a large part of the old, massive CEC complex had been temporarily closed down or rented out to Duracrete's mining wing. At any given time, only a half dozen small pits saw any activity, and it was a rare day that more than 2 or 3 cargo shuttles left the site, bound for the watery world in the next orbit.*

*The Corellian Engineering Corporation mining operations continued to grow and expand, while still on a small scale, as new teams of miners, engineers, and analysts were dispatched across the planet's unpopulated areas, scouting locations, testing them with core samples, and erecting new mining rigs at the most promising sites. At the same time, the existing mines were reorganized and modernized with new equipment, and as the months went by, they began to pool enough ore for the refineries to justify the dispatch of a new convoy to carry the ore home to the Corellian system and process it further. Orders were placed by the various shipyards in the Corellian system, as word went around that the previous year's stores of ore and other resources was quickly being exhausted. With many new CEC projects in the offing, as well as a plane to create several new fleets for the Navy of the United Federation of Free Worlds, CEC decided that it was past time to get serious about mining again, and began making arrangements for cargo convoys, guarded by a handful of starfighters, to begin making the rounds of the various mines and bringing home the stores that had been building up for several months while CEC worked its way through what had been an excess of materials.*

*The Sea of Jorad was alive with dozens of the wide-hulled, oared wooden vessels known locally as nagaks, as the annual styanax hunt reached its peak. Stabmen, armed with lethal harpoons crouched in the bow of each ship as the vessels skated noiselessly across the water, fixed their eyes motionlessly on the undersea landscape. It wouldn't do to attract unnecessary attention from the crafty, serpentine kings of the undersea. Most stynax would flee to the depths to hide, but some of the largest of the ferocious, armored creatures had been known to fight back with their jaws or their stingers. Selonian and human stabmen kept mental track of the only score that really mattered --- which species had the biggest kill. It was tradition, and they loved the friendly competition.*
